Description

The Foothills Food Bank & Resource Center is a vital non-profit organization dedicated to combating food insecurity and promoting self-sufficiency within the northern desert foothills communities of Arizona, including Cave Creek, Carefree, Anthem, and surrounding areas. Established in 1988, this community-driven food bank provides emergency food assistance, including fresh produce, meats, and pantry staples, alongside crucial financial aid and essential household and personal hygiene items to individuals and families in need. With a strong emphasis on holistic support, they also offer resource referrals and community navigation services, empowering clients towards independence and a brighter future. Supported by dedicated volunteers and community partnerships, the Foothills Food Bank & Resource Center is a cornerstone of local welfare, ensuring access to nutritious food and vital resources for a diverse demographic, including seniors and those in precarious living situations.
